- [ ] **Step 7: Breaker override escrow.** After sealing the signing keys for the Tallgrove upstream API circuit breaker, confirm the support team can force the breaker open during a full outage. The override bundle lives in the sealed escrow drawer and is useless without its unlock phrase. Two ceremony witnesses must initial this step before proceeding. The escrow bundle is decrypted with the recovery passphrase that follows.

vault phrase of kahip-kahop = holath-quenmir

## Welcome to Fixtureforge

Fixtureforge is our test-data factory library — you ask it for a fake customer, order, or invoice and it hands back something schema-valid with sensible defaults. Don't hand-roll fixtures; it'll bite you at migration time. Seeds live in the sealed config bundle so CI stays deterministic. To unlock that bundle locally, use the recovery passphrase recorded just below.

unlock words, hahip-baduf: holwyn-istath-julvan

I'm transferring ownership of the date-formatting layer, which renders dates per user locale across the web and mobile clients. Known quirks: week-start settings override locale defaults if set before v4.2, and a few legacy accounts still show ISO format regardless of preference — there's an open ticket for that. Support should keep routing formatting complaints through the usual queue; nothing changes on your side except who triages them. As of next Monday, the responsible engineer is named below.

signatory, kafop-bahaf: Lamion Queniel Jorir Olidor